當前位置:首頁 » 圖片大全 » 圖片一個像素佔多少位元組
擴展閱讀
文件夾背景圖片變白色 2025-07-11 16:19:51
男酷圖片大全 2025-07-11 16:19:36

圖片一個像素佔多少位元組

發布時間: 2023-08-16 20:08:37

⑴ 圖片內存大小計算

圖片內存大小 圖片文件佔用空間大小 是沒有必然關系,但是一般來說圖片文件大小,圖片內存大小就越大。佔用空間是在磁碟上佔用的空間,內存大小是載入到內存中佔用的內存大小。

現在假如有一個圖片是600*800的,文件大小100KB。

圖片內存大小的計算公式是 : 圖片高度 * 圖片寬度 * 一個像素佔用的位元組數

也就是 600 * 800 * 4 byte = 1875KB = 1.83M

而一個像素佔用的位元組數與圖片的編碼格式(或者叫bitmap在內存中的存儲形式)有關

自然是位數越多顯示的效果越好

在Android中,圖片的存放目錄和手機的屏幕密度影響圖片最終的大小,舉個例子:

假設我們的圖片放到xhdpi目錄下,那麼我們本文中的圖片佔用的內存大小如下:

屏幕密度為2的設備:800 * 600 * 4byte = 1.83M

屏幕密度為3的設備:800 * 1.5 * 600 * 1.5 * 4byte = 1.83 * 2.25M = 4.12M

所以,計算圖片佔用內存大小的時候,要考慮圖片所在的目錄跟設備密度,這兩個因素其實影響的是圖片的高寬,android會對圖片進行拉升跟壓縮。

⑵ 關於png圖片內存大小計算

圖片所佔內存大小 = 圖片長度(像素) * 圖片寬度(像素) * 一個像素所佔內存空間(單位:位元組)
一個像素佔32位,8位=1位元組,所以一個像素佔4位元組的內存
RGBA8888下一個象素所佔內存空間為4個位元組。
RGBA8888 是32位
1像素 = 32位 = 4B
所以 一張1024 1024大小的圖片所佔的內存是 1024 1024*4B = 4M

⑶ 在黑白圖像中,一個像素占幾bit

1個位元組佔用8bit.

⑷ 一張圖片佔多大內存怎麼算

圖像文件的位元組數=圖像解析度*顏色深度/8
不知道你的深度是多少,一般是24
680X750X24/8=1530000位元組
1530000/1024=1494KB
1494/1024=1.46MB
以上只是基本原理演算法
格式不同文件壓縮品質也就是不同的。

⑸ 一個像素的存儲空間是多少

像素的存儲謹扮或空間取決於像素深度。例如,RGB 5∶5∶5表示一個像素時,用2個位元組共16位表示。

像素深度是指存儲每個像素所用的位數,也用它來度量圖像的解析度。像素深度決定彩色圖像的每個像素可能有的顏色數,或者確定灰度圖像的每個像素可能有的灰度級數。

例如,一幅彩色圖像的每個像素用R,G,B三個分量表示,若每個分量用8位,那麼一個像素共用24位表示,就說像缺如素的深度為24,每個像素可以是16 777 216(2的24次方)種顏色中的一種。在這個意義上,往往把像素深度說成是圖像深度。表示一個像素的位數越多,它能表達的顏色數目就越多,而它的深度就越深。

(5)圖片一個像素佔多少位元組擴展閱讀:

單位祥伍

當圖片尺寸以像素為單位時,需要指定其固定的解析度,才能將圖片尺寸與現實中的實際尺寸相互轉換。

例如大多數網頁製作常用圖片解析度為72,即每英寸像素為72,1英寸等於2.54厘米,那麼通過換算可以得出每厘米等於28像素;又如15x15厘米長度的圖片,等於420*420像素的長度。